Mandalynn Marcus
Program Director and Assistant Professor I
Email: mmarcus2@cocc.edu 

Mandalynn Marcus is a seasoned health information management professional with over 20 years of experience. In addition to a master's degree in health informatics and a bachelor’s health information management, she holds six specialized certifications, highlighting her dedication to staying at the forefront of industry advancements.

After many years in the health information field, Mandalynn was compelled to use her expertise as a college professor. “My top priority is creating a classroom environment that nurtures curiosity and critical thinking,” she says. “This helps ensure graduates are able to thrive as professionals in the field.” Some of her favorite courses to teach include Health Information Standards, Reimbursement Systems, and Quality Improvement in Health Care.

Students in Mandalynn’s courses quickly discover her focus on continuous improvement. This emphasis also comes through whether she is mentoring colleagues, conducting workshops, or participating in professional development initiatives. “It’s all about elevating the profession and ensuring students are ready for entry into this dynamic career,” she says.
